Mussel Scale (Lepidosaphes ulmi): A Significant Armored Scale Pest

Mussel Scale (Lepidosaphes ulmi) The mussel scale (Lepidosaphes ulmi) is a highly destructive armored scale insect belonging to the family Diaspididae. Recognized for its polyphagous feeding behavior, this pest infests a wide range of plant species, including fruit trees, ornamental plants, and shrubs, posing a severe threat to both agricultural and horticultural industries. Understanding Brown Soft Scale: A Highly Effective Pest Guide

Brown Soft Scale: A Significant Agricultural and Ornamental Pest The brown soft scale (Coccus hesperidum) is a widespread sap-feeding insect belonging to the Coccidae family (soft scales, formerly Lecaniidae). Improving Soil Carbon Models Using Energy Transformations and Optimality

Introduction Soil organic carbon (SOC) cycling is a fundamental process in the Earth system, influencing climate regulation, ecosystem productivity, and soil health (Lal, 2004). Current soil carbon models primarily rely on mass balance equations, which focus on carbon fluxes but overlook the critical role of energy transformations that occur simultaneously (Manzoni & Porporato, 2009).
